Common Pine Floor Installation Jobs
Pine flooring installation involves fitting new pine planks to enhance the appearance of interior spaces.
Pine floor refinishing restores the natural beauty of existing pine floors through sanding and sealing.
Pine flooring replacement removes damaged or outdated pine boards and installs fresh, durable planks.
Custom pine flooring projects include unique patterns, borders, or finishes tailored to homeowner preferences.
Pine floor repair addresses issues such as cracks, splinters, or uneven surfaces for a smooth finish.
Historic pine flooring restoration preserves the character of vintage homes with careful installation and finishing.
Pine Floor Installation Questions
What types of flooring materials are suitable for installation? Pine flooring can be installed over various subfloors and is compatible with different finishes, making it versatile for many interior styles.
How should a property owner prepare for pine floor installation? Clear the area of furniture and debris, and ensure the subfloor is clean and level to facilitate a smooth installation process.
Can pine flooring be installed in high-traffic areas? Yes, with proper finishing and maintenance, pine flooring can withstand high-traffic environments and maintain its appearance.
What are common projects that involve pine floor installation? Typical projects include home renovations, new constructions, or adding character to historic or rustic-style interiors.
